Ever wondered how to get more done in less time? The secret often lies in using the right tools to streamline your workflow. That’s where productivity-boosting Chrome extensions come into play. These tools can help you automate repetitive tasks and block distractions, making it easier to stay focused and efficient throughout your day. Task automation extensions can handle everything from saving links to managing emails, so you don’t waste precious minutes on mundane activities. For example, you can set up extensions that automatically save articles or web pages to your preferred notes app, or ones that fill out repetitive forms with a single click. This way, you free up mental energy and time for the work that truly matters, rather than getting bogged down in manual tasks. Distraction blocking extensions are equally essential. They prevent you from drifting into time-wasting websites or social media platforms when you need to concentrate. You can customize these extensions to block specific sites during designated hours, helping you stay on task. When you combine task automation with distraction blocking, you create a focused digital environment that keeps interruptions at bay and maximizes your productivity. These tools work seamlessly in the background, allowing you to set up routines that run automatically. For instance, you might configure an extension to remind you to take breaks after a certain period or to automatically mute notifications during deep work sessions. This proactive approach helps you maintain a steady flow of work without constant manual intervention. Many extensions also offer valuable features like scheduling, note-taking, and tracking your time, giving you a comprehensive toolkit to manage your day efficiently. How Do I Install Chrome Extensions Safely?

To install Chrome extensions safely, start by checking extension permissions to make certain they’re necessary and trustworthy. Only download from the Chrome Web Store and avoid third-party sources. After installation, keep your extensions updated to benefit from security improvements. Regularly review your installed extensions, removing any unused or suspicious ones. This way, you maintain control over your browsing safety and protect your data from potential risks.

How Do I Manage Extension Permissions?

Managing extension permissions is like controlling a superhero’s powers—you hold the key. To do this, go to Chrome’s settings, click on “Extensions,” and select “Details” for each extension. Here, you can review and adjust extension privacy and permission management, ensuring your data stays safe. Regularly check these settings to prevent overreach and keep your browsing secure. Do Chrome Extensions Work Offline?

Yes, some Chrome extensions work offline, giving you offline functionality for certain tasks. To guarantee this, check the extension’s compatibility and whether it explicitly states offline support. Not all extensions are designed for offline use, so you might need to explore options that specify offline mode. When an extension is compatible, it can store data locally, allowing you to access features without an internet connection.
